M7-3 TRIGONOMETRIC LEVELING. A vertical angle of -12°25' is measured to the
top of a water tank from an instrument set up on a hill 585.00 meters away
from it. The telescope of the instrument is 1.45 m above the ground whose
elevation is 462.73 m. Making due allowance for the earth's curvature and
atmospheric refraction, determine the elevation of the base of the water
tank is the tank is 32.0 m high.
